Output 21c350b60b974f5a80b0cee38466a54d364421ef93d90e461749eeb71a71a8f6:0

value
18000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32c8bb0e145756ba1506707fb0b953e7ea5bc71b OP_EQUALVERIFY OP_CHECKSIG
address
15dXFc2bq8EN9BKSjjQFfkdpaGv1V9Y9hE
transaction
21c350b60b974f5a80b0cee38466a54d364421ef93d90e461749eeb71a71a8f6
spent
true